Output 38d55aa9a25652c79109081b9472265fda93d336be3176e7181ce99fdee0502c:1

value
43420920
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d8d8158331750cc0a36644d5232891044735d16e OP_EQUALVERIFY OP_CHECKSIG
address
1LmZpDbfG1SKCDvyQsYov73N1okXyK9nwx
transaction
38d55aa9a25652c79109081b9472265fda93d336be3176e7181ce99fdee0502c
confirmations
572632
spent
true